作業系統

當前位置 /首頁/計算機/作業系統/列表

作業系統的發展與分類

1.2 作業系統的發展與分類

作業系統的發展與分類

本節簡要複習一下操作系統的發展和分類。

1.2.1 作業系統的發展

作業系統是計算機系統中最基本的系統軟體,它是隨著計算機研究和應用的'發展而逐步形成並發展起來的。通常,人們按照計算機元件工藝的演變過程,將計算機硬體的發展劃分為四個時代:電子管時代、電晶體時代、積體電路時代和大規模積體電路時代。相應地,人們也將作業系統的發展過程劃分為四個時代:單道批處理時代,多道批處理時代,分時、實時系統時代,同時具有多方面功能的多方式系統時代和分散式系統時代。

1.2.2 作業系統的分類

隨著計算機硬體及其應用的不斷髮展,作業系統的型別也逐漸多樣化。作業系統的6種主要分類方式如下:

按使用者數目,分為單使用者作業系統和多使用者作業系統。其中,單使用者作業系統又分為單任務作業系統和多工作業系統;

按硬體結構,分為單CPU作業系統、多CPU作業系統、網路作業系統、分散式作業系統和多媒體作業系統;

按使用環境,分為批處理作業系統、分時作業系統和實時作業系統;

按管理的機型,分個人計算機作業系統、伺服器作業系統、大型計算機作業系統和嵌入式作業系統;

按使用範圍,分為通用作業系統和專用作業系統。前者可適應多種硬體平臺,可安裝在多個廠家生產的計算機上,如Linux、Windows;後者只能在特定的系統上工作,如IBM OS/360;

按歷史的發展,分為傳統作業系統和現代作業系統。前者一般是指最初的單道作業系統、單處理機作業系統等;後者是具有多道功能的、支援多處理機、網路的、分散式的作業系統。

TAG標籤:作業系統 #